Journalist Salary in Fairbanks, Alaska
The median journalist salary in Fairbanks, AK is $72,748 per year, which is 30.0% above the national median and 4.8% above the Alaska state average.

Journalist Salary in Fairbanks by Experience
In Fairbanks, an entry-level journalist earns around $45,500, while experienced professionals earn up to $130,000 per year. The local cost of living index is 130% of the national average.

Job Outlook
Nationally, journalist employment is projected to grow -3% over the next decade (decline). Demand in Fairbanks may vary based on local industry and population growth.
